Coins

Issue date 04 Jun 1972

Overview

The coins series depicted the one cent square coin of King George V, the 1972 Singapore $1 coin and the $150 gold coin. The $150 gold coin was released to commemorate the 150th anniversary of the founding of modern Singapore in 1969. This stamp series was issued on 4 June 1972.

Coins
Coins
Coins
Technical specifications
Denomination15¢, 35¢, $1
Stamp Size40mm x 28.5mm
Perforation13½ x 13¼
PrintingLithography
Sheet Content50 stamps per sheet
PrinterB Wilkinson
Graphic DesignerWilliam Lee
